EVANSTON, Ill. – Northwestern hosts Penn State on Thursday for a conference battle in the Together We Win game. Tip-off is set for 7 p.m. CT and will be broadcast on B1G+. 
 
The Wildcats sit at 11-5 on the season and 3-2 in conference play after falling to Michigan State on Sunday.
 
First-year Caileigh Walsh recorded her eighth-career double-digit scoring game with 10 points, while junior Laya Hartman also contributed 10 points in 19 minutes.
 
This is the 50th meeting all-time between Penn State and Northwestern. The 'Cats are 4-0 against Penn State dating back to 2018-19. 
 
Veronica Burton is putting together an outstanding season, leading the Wildcats at 17.4 point per game, while ranking third in the nation with 68 steals (4.25 per game). Burton also ranks second in the conference at 6.0 assists per game. 
 
At 9.9 points per game, Caleigh Walsh is set to be the highest-scoring first-year for Northwestern since Lindsey Pulliam averaged 15.0 points per game in her rookie season (2017-18).
